Size and Weight Comparison The size of a lens is a crucial factor to consider when comparing two lenses. Nikon Z 24-105mm F4-7.1 is the longer of the two lenses at 107mm. The Nikon Z 16-50mm F2.8 with a length of 88mm, is 19mm shorter. On the other hand, the Nikon Z 16-50mm F2.8 has a larger diameter of 75mm compared to the Nikon Z 24-105mm F4-7.1's 74mm diameter.

Comparison image of the Nikon Z 24-105mm F4-7.1 and the Nikon Z 16-50mm F2.8 Size and Weight The weight of a lens is equally significant as its external dimensions, particularly if you intend to handhold your camera and lens combination for extended periods. Nikon Z 16-50mm F2.8 weighs 330g, 5% (20g) lighter than the Nikon Z 24-105mm F4-7.1's weight of 350g.

Focal Range
Nikon Z 24-105mm F4-7.1 has a focal range of 24-105mm and
4.4X zoom ratio . When it is mounted on an APS-C sensor camera with 1.6x crop, it provides a 35mm (FF) equivalent of
38.4 - 168mm .
On the other hand, the Nikon Z 16-50mm F2.8 has a focal range of 16-50mm and 3.1X zoom ratio which has an effective (full-frame 35mm equivalent) focal range of 24-75mm when used on a APS-C / DX format camera.
